Our lab has developed vectors for C. elegans transgenesis.

These vectors are for germline expression only. They use sequences from the pie-1 gene (promoter, intron and 3’ sequences) to drive expression of ORFs (or GFP-ORF fusions) in the maternal germline. The pie-1 vectors are especially well suited for maternal expression of transgenic proteins in oocytes and early embryos.

THIRD GENERATION SEYDOUX LAB VECTOR KIT

The purpose of kit is to create transgenes that can be used to transform unc-119 worms by bombardment. The kit is modular allowing the user to choose promoter, ORF, and 3’ sequences and thus is suitable for expression in any tissue.
